There are just a few days left until the fourth swashbuckling instalment of Assassin’s Creed arrives on consoles.

This new story in the historical action-adventure saga has a pirate theme, which players will be able to experience when Black Flag sails into view from October 29 for PS3 and Xbox 360.

Set in 18th Caribbean when outlaws ruled the waves as well as on land, Ubisoft is promising the game will be the “fullest Assassin’s Creed world ever created” with a more open-world feel than previous episodes.

Players will be able to visit more than 50 locations including the cities of Havana, Kingston and Nassau, exploring various settings such as jungles, forts and ruins.

At sea, they will be able to board and capture passing ships.

Features you’ll be able to plunder include captaining and customising your own ship, searching for lost treasure, hunting rare animals and looting underwater shipwrecks.

The central character in Black Flag is described as “young, cocky, and fearsome captain” named Edward Kenway, two of whose descendants were the playable characters of Assassin's Creed III.

Legendary pirates such as Blackbeard, Calico Jack and Benjamin Hornigold feature in the game.
